The Official Comment to the statute states that the purpose of the statute is to authorize the court to decide that another state is in a better position to make the custody determination, taking into consideration the relative circumstances of the parties. It seems obvious the drafters mean the circumstances of the parties at the time the custody determination is to be made. 0000056455 00000 n Our appellate courts have not answered this specific question, and GS 50A-207(a) states that the court may decline to exercise jurisdiction at any time it determines North Carolina is an inconvenient forum. If venue is changed, the grand jury in the county to which the case is transferred has the power to return an indictment in the case; if an indictment has already been returned, then no new indictment is necessary and the prosecution may move forward on the existing indictment. Ramnishta, 848 S.E.2d 542 (September 1, 2020)(the trial court can consider post-filing occurrences to determine that another state is a more convenient forum because the court can make this determination at any time during a pending custody action). This might include the issuance of temporary custody orders during the time necessary to commence a proceeding in the designated State, dismissing the case if the custody proceeding is not commenced in the other State or resuming jurisdiction if a court of the other State refuses to take the case.. A North Carolina corporation resides wherever its registered or physical office is located, where it maintains a place of business, or if neither of these are applicable, anywhere the corporation regularly does business. A court with jurisdiction to make a child custody determination may decline to exercise its jurisdiction at any time if it determines that it is an inconvenient forum under the circumstances, and that a court of another state is a more appropriate forum.
